12427189
0xcac1ee1d40a60ea0729c8fdfebd40c7580e96fdeb6b1349b018d6e4c865207ea
Transactions0
Height12427189
Confirmations3494303
Timestamp295 days 9 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xe50418d0ee0dd93d
Bits
Difficulty0x33c627dd